I recently bought a 2000 CR-V EX. It came with a standard remote keyless
entry. I was wondering if I purchase a Honda security unit...can I still use
the same remote for it. What do I need to buy? Can I install it myself? Do
I just plug in the alarm to an exixting harness? I need some info........

The factory alarm gives you two remotes that look similar to the original remotes except they have a panic button.  You do have to use the new remotes in order to effectively use the alarm.  If you use the old remotes all you will do is lock the vehicle without activating the alarm.


I had my dealer install it so the warranty will be in effect.  You could install it yourself, but it does require some drilling for the alarm activation LED and the valet button.  I am not sure about the wiring harness, but most likely it is fairly straight forward to connect.
